Do You Meet the Prerequisites for State Tested Nursing Assistant classes?

The prerequisites for State Tested nurse aide programs vary from one program to the next, but most do have some standardized ones. You’ll have to be the legal age, already have a high school diploma or GED, pass a background screening and then you must have a negative test result for Tuberculosis and Hepatitis.

Starting Your Career as a State Tested Nurse Assistant in Rome OH

If you ever plan to be a nursing aide you need to know what steps you’ve got to complete. The steps in the certification process are highlighted directly below.

    •Productively Finish Your Accredited State Tested Nursing Assistant Courses
    •Applying and Properly Passing the <a href="Ohio Nurse Assistant Exam” target=”_blank”>National STNA Assessment Program NNAAP
    •Registration in the OH Nursing Aide Registry

Every Ohio State Tested nursing aide training curriculum have to have 100 hours in courses which has at the minimum 50 hours of practical training.
